Table des matières:
Vidéo: Effet de flamme vacillante réaliste avec Arduino et LED : 4 étapes
2025 Auteur: John Day | [email protected]. Dernière modifié: 2025-01-13 06:57
Dans ce projet, nous utiliserons 3 LED et un Arduino pour créer un effet de feu réaliste qui pourrait être utilisé dans un diorama, un chemin de fer miniature ou une fausse cheminée dans votre maison ou en mettre un dans un bocal ou un tube en verre dépoli et personne ne le saura ce n'était pas une vraie bougie à l'intérieur. C'est un projet vraiment simple adapté aux débutants.
Étape 1: Étape 1 - Câblez les LED
Câblez 3 LED. Utilisez 2 x jaune diffus et 1 x rouge diffus. Vous pouvez augmenter le nombre de LED si vous souhaitez un affichage plus grand ou plus lumineux. Envisagez l'utilisation de transistors si votre ampérage dépasse celui qui peut être fourni par l'Arduino. Utilisez des résistances adaptées à votre type particulier de LED.
Étape 2: Entrez le code
Entrez ce code:// LED Fire Effectint ledPin1 = 10;int ledPin2 = 9;int ledPin3 = 11;void setup(){pinMode(ledPin1, OUTPUT);pinMode(ledPin2, OUTPUT);pinMode(ledPin3, OUTPUT);} boucle vide() {analogWrite(ledPin1, random(120)+135);analogWrite(ledPin2, random(120)+135);analogWrite(ledPin3, random(120)+135);delay(random(100));}
Étape 3: Télécharger et exécuter
Téléchargez le code sur l'Arduino et exécutez-le. Vous aurez maintenant un effet flamme/feu assez réaliste grâce aux LED. Faites rebondir la lumière sur une carte blanche ou un miroir pour obtenir le plein effet.
Étape 4: Vidéo de l'effet
Vidéo de l'effet. Les couleurs et l'effet n'apparaissent pas très bien dans la vidéo. Dans la vraie vie, c'est un effet de flamme très efficace. Essaie.